Milla and Luka are 3 kilometers apart and walking toward each other. Milla's average speed is 5 kilometers per hour and Luka's i

s 4 kilometers per hour. Which equation can be used to find t, the time it takes for Milla and Luka to meet? 5t + 4t = 1 5t + 4t = 3 5t – 4t = 0 5t – 4t = 3

Answer:-5t + 4t = 3 is the equation can be used to find t, where t is the time it takes for Milla and Luka to meet


Explanation:-

Given: Milla and Luka are 3 kilometers apart and walking toward each other.

⇒ Distance between them = 3 km

Milla's average speed u=5 kilometers per hour

and Luka's v= 4 kilometers per hour.

Therefore the resultant average speed = u+v=(5+4) kilometers per hour.

We know that <em>Distance =speed × time</em>

⇒Distance between them= resultant average speed × time

⇒3=(5+4)×t        , where t is time  it takes for Milla and Luka to meet

⇒3=5t+4t            [distributive property]

Thus ,  5t + 4t = 3 is the equation can be used to find t, where t is the time it takes for Milla and Luka to meet
